Deck 16: Neurophysiology of Nerve Impulses: Frog Subjects
1
If a stimulus to a neuron is great enough, is reached and an action potential is generated.

A)threshold
B)depolarization
C)repolarization
D)resting membrane potential
A
2
Which nerve innervates the gastrocnemius muscle of the frog?

A)fibular
B)sciatic (tibial branch)
C)plantar
D)femoral
B
3
An action potential results from _ .

A)changes in the permeability of the neuron membrane to K+ alone
B)changes in the permeability of the neuron membrane to Na+ alone
C)a change in the permeability of the neuron to Na+ followed by a change in the permeability to K+
D)a change in the permeability of the neuron to K+ followed by a change in the permeability to Na+
C
4
The neurotransmitter released from the axon terminal _ .

A)inhibits the next cell
B)may excite or inhibit the next cell depending on which receptors for the neurotransmitter are present
C)varies in its effect, depending on the shape of the action potential
D)excites the next cell
